Introduction


This training session addresses the often confusing and complex U.S. tax residency rules and the underlying immigration categories on which they are based. This training features dedicated tracks with consecutive days of substantive tax and immigration based lecture sessions followed by consecutive days of software training . This format gives you the flexibility to attend all four days of training, or just the two days that are specific to your needs.

Our Objectives


  • To identify what immigration categories and their related documents authorize payments to foreign nationals and how foreign nationals’ current and past immigration categories and U.S. days of presence determine U.S. tax residency.
  • To apply federal tax rules for determining the character and source of income and determine appropriated tax withholding and reporting documents based on U.S. tax residency of the income recipient and type of payment.
  • To determine the conditions that must be met by foreign nationals claiming exemptions from tax under income tax treaty provisions and the withholding documents required for exemption based on the payment.
  • To apply the International Tax Navigator® functionality to:
    1) collect relevant immigration status and U.S. presence data
    2) determine residency status
    3) determine availability of treaty benefits on a case-by-case basis
    4) complete required withholding documents for signature by income recipients
    5) complete IRS reporting documents

Faculty


Gary Singer is a computer systems specialist and co-founder of Windstar Technologies, Inc., which develops and distributes software for nonresident alien tax compliance and case-by-case tax treaty analysis. Gary has over 30 years of experience designing, developing and managing complex computer software applications. Since 1994, he has devoted his attention to providing a software solution for nonresident alien tax compliance and tax treaty analyses for administrators making payments to foreign nationals and foreign entities.

Paula Singer, Esq. has advised individuals and businesses on tax planning and compliance for individuals relocating internationally since 1979. She is a partner in the tax law firm, Vacovec, Mayotte & Singer, and co-founder of Windstar Technologies, Inc. Paula concentrates her practice on cross border tax and legal matters for individuals and businesses. In 1995, she assisted the IRS with the design of the Form 1040NR-EZ Tax Return. Prior to entering law, Paula was a software developer for 10 years. She frequently lectures on international tax matters and has published numerous articles on international tax topics. In 2000, the founders of Windstar Technologies Inc. launched Windstar Publishing, Inc. Windstar Publishing produces an easy to understand series of books under the collective title U.S. Tax Guides for Foreign Persons and Those Who Pay Them® by Paula Singer.

Linda Dodd-Major is an attorney providing strategic consulting for U.S. immigration matters pertaining to business, investment, employment, and training as well as employment eligibility verification (Form I-9) compliance. Linda was nationally known for many years as creator and director of the INS’ Office of Business Liaison, in which capacity she was responsible for developing public information to raise awareness and understanding of laws prohibiting illegal employment and obtaining international services in the U.S. Her expertise involves conversion of complex, interrelated laws, regulations, policies, and procedures into practical options for lay as well as legal communities. A popular national and international lecturer, she focuses on key interrelationships among the overlapping, intersecting, and interdependent jurisdictions of many U.S. government and other entities including the Departments of Homeland Security, Justice (Office of Special Counsel), State, Commerce, Labor, Treasury and Defense as well as the IRS and Social Security Administration. Linda holds advanced degrees in law and international business from Rutgers and Georgetown Universities.

Scott Annis, Director of ERP Interfaces for Windstar Technologies, Inc., manages the technical hardware and software support for all of the Windstar Technologies Inc.products and its clients. In addition, Scott has developed custom software applications as well as custom client reports for Windstar products. During his sessions, Scott will concentrate on the technical aspects of implementing the International Tax Navigator®, mail merge, crystal reports and interfacing issues.

Terri Crowl has been working in the field of nonimmigrant taxation since the early 1990s, and joined the Windstar Technologies staff on a full time basis as Senior Product Support Analyst in March, 2007. In her current role, she assists clients with the Tax Navigator product including treaty analysis, processing procedures, system function analysis and product and tax issue training. She has been part of the Windstar staff on a part-time basis since 2001, and most recently served as the International Tax Coordinator at George Mason University in Fairfax, VA, where she oversaw all payments made by the university to nonimmigrants and ensured proper tax reporting and withholding. At Mason Terri provided tax preparation workshops for its nonresident alien population. In addition to Mason and Windstar training sessions, Terri has been a presenter at two International Tax Summits at St. Norbert College and at the Region VIII NAFSA conference.

Marianne Couch, Esq., is a principal with COKALA Tax Information Reporting Solutions, LLC and is a nationally known advisor and author on U.S. federal and state tax information reporting compliance, and a frequent lecturer at major tax conferences. She served for many years as Research Director of Balance Consulting, and chaired special training and advisory services provided to large organizations and nonprofit institutions. She is a former member of the IRS Information Reporting Program Advisory Committee (IRPAC) and Chair of the IRPAC Subcommittee on Small Business and Self-Employed (SBSE) tax issues. In this capacity, she testified annually before the IRS Commissioner on issues of concern to the information reporting community. Marianne previously worked for a large Michigan law firm, and served as a Research Attorney for the Michigan Court of Appeals.
